INHERITED PROPERTY OR GIFTS
A common concern among people separating is what will happen to money or property they inherited or were given before they were married or during the time they were married.
As long as the property or funds remain separate and separately titled during the marriage and are not commingled (mixed) with marital funds or property, the inherited or gifted money or property will remain separate and will not be divided when you separate or divorce.
However, separate money or property that is commingled (mixed) with marital money or property can become marital property that is divided at the time of separation or divorce.
